"Improved from AKM rifles?" Seifer was a little puzzled, "Isn't the accuracy of the AKM rifle always bad?" To improve a firearm with poor accuracy to a sniper rifle is simply an incredible idea. ”

Albert had to explain to him slowly, "The air piston of the SVD is different from the AKM, the piston of the AKM is integrated with the bolt frame, while the SVD adopts the design of a short-stroke piston, the air piston is located separately in the piston barrel, and moves backwards under the pressure of gunpowder gas, hitting the frame to make it recoil, which can reduce the center of gravity offset caused by the movement of the piston and the piston connecting rod, thereby improving the shooting accuracy." ”

"And the SVD has a flap-shaped flame suppressor at the nose end of the barrel with a length of 70mm, it has 5 slots, 3 of which are located in the upper part and 2 in the bottom. In this way, more gas is discharged from the upper part of the extinguisher than from the bottom, and the actual effect is to press the muzzle down to reduce the muzzle jump to a certain extent. In addition, the front end of the flame suppressor is tapered, forming an inclined plane, which blocks a part of the gunpowder gas and causes it to be retracted to reduce the recoil of the gun. ”
